Windrichtung 8 Sektoren pot.-frei
Moderator: Co-Administratoren
-
- Beiträge: 12108
- Registriert: 20.11.2016, 20:01
- Hat sich bedankt: 848 Mal
- Danksagung erhalten: 2148 Mal
- Kontaktdaten:
Re: Windrichtung 8 Sektoren pot.-frei
Das ist mein Board:
Und wenn ich einen Pin gegen Vcc halte, dann ändert sich der winddir Wert.
Kurzes Video befindet sich hier:
https://www.dropbox.com/s/g67uyanf2y5vu ... 2.mov?dl=0
Mehr kann ich dann leider auch nicht für dich tun.
PCF8574A steht drauf und hat die Adresse 0x38 gejumpert.Und wenn ich einen Pin gegen Vcc halte, dann ändert sich der winddir Wert.
Kurzes Video befindet sich hier:
https://www.dropbox.com/s/g67uyanf2y5vu ... 2.mov?dl=0
Mehr kann ich dann leider auch nicht für dich tun.
-
- Beiträge: 52
- Registriert: 08.03.2019, 12:17
- Hat sich bedankt: 7 Mal
- Danksagung erhalten: 2 Mal
Re: Windrichtung 8 Sektoren pot.-frei
gibt es bei dem Board einen Eingang und Ausgang?
ich hab mich an der anderen Seite angeklemmt.
Ich setzte mich am WE nochmal ran und probiere. Vielleicht kommt ja noch der "N" Chip. Ein Board mit A habe ich leider nicht gefunden.
Hast du das Board mit 3.3V versorgt oder mit 5V?
ich hab mich an der anderen Seite angeklemmt.
Ich setzte mich am WE nochmal ran und probiere. Vielleicht kommt ja noch der "N" Chip. Ein Board mit A habe ich leider nicht gefunden.
Hast du das Board mit 3.3V versorgt oder mit 5V?
-
- Beiträge: 12108
- Registriert: 20.11.2016, 20:01
- Hat sich bedankt: 848 Mal
- Danksagung erhalten: 2148 Mal
- Kontaktdaten:
Re: Windrichtung 8 Sektoren pot.-frei
Nein, das ist durchgeschleift. Ist egal welche Seite du anschließt
3.3V, wie fast alles in der AskSin-Welt
-
- Beiträge: 52
- Registriert: 08.03.2019, 12:17
- Hat sich bedankt: 7 Mal
- Danksagung erhalten: 2 Mal
Re: Windrichtung 8 Sektoren pot.-frei
Jetzt geht gar nichts mehr.
Der I2C Scanner geht noch. Der Rest nicht mehr.
Und die eine LED auf dem Mini ist nach dem Start dauerhaft an
Der I2C Scanner geht noch. Der Rest nicht mehr.
Und die eine LED auf dem Mini ist nach dem Start dauerhaft an
-
- Beiträge: 52
- Registriert: 08.03.2019, 12:17
- Hat sich bedankt: 7 Mal
- Danksagung erhalten: 2 Mal
Re: Windrichtung 8 Sektoren pot.-frei
Nabend,
alles sehr strange...
ich hab mir jetzt nochmal einen PCF8574A IC besorgt und auch nochmal einen neue Pro Mini.
I2C Scanner: 0x38 gefunden!
Dann habe ich den Beispiel-Sketch KeyPressedPin1 geladen und probiert!
Funktioniert einwandfrei auch mit Pin 2 - immer gegen GND Bei deinem Testsketch passiert aber immer noch nichts...
Hättest du noch ne Idee?
alles sehr strange...
ich hab mir jetzt nochmal einen PCF8574A IC besorgt und auch nochmal einen neue Pro Mini.
I2C Scanner: 0x38 gefunden!
Dann habe ich den Beispiel-Sketch KeyPressedPin1 geladen und probiert!
Funktioniert einwandfrei auch mit Pin 2 - immer gegen GND Bei deinem Testsketch passiert aber immer noch nichts...
Hättest du noch ne Idee?
-
- Beiträge: 12108
- Registriert: 20.11.2016, 20:01
- Hat sich bedankt: 848 Mal
- Danksagung erhalten: 2148 Mal
- Kontaktdaten:
Re: Windrichtung 8 Sektoren pot.-frei
Adresse hast du in meinem Sketch auf 0x38 geändert?
Zeile 34: PCF8574_WindDir<0x38> pcf;
Baudrate im seriellen Monitor hast du auf 57600 Baud eingestellt?
Zeile 34: PCF8574_WindDir<0x38> pcf;
Baudrate im seriellen Monitor hast du auf 57600 Baud eingestellt?
-
- Beiträge: 12108
- Registriert: 20.11.2016, 20:01
- Hat sich bedankt: 848 Mal
- Danksagung erhalten: 2148 Mal
- Kontaktdaten:
Re: Windrichtung 8 Sektoren pot.-frei
In deinem funktionierenden Testsketch prüfst du auf "val == LOW".
Das heißt, so lange da kein HIGH kommt, wird fortlaufend "KEY PRESSED" ausgegeben.
Stoppt diese Ausgabe denn wenn du P2 auf Vcc verbindest?
Und was kommt wenn du nur den Read von P2 mal in dem winndir Testsketch ausgeben lässt?
Also in der loop() einfach noch ein anhängen
Das heißt, so lange da kein HIGH kommt, wird fortlaufend "KEY PRESSED" ausgegeben.
Stoppt diese Ausgabe denn wenn du P2 auf Vcc verbindest?
Und was kommt wenn du nur den Read von P2 mal in dem winndir Testsketch ausgeben lässt?
Also in der loop() einfach noch ein
Code: Alles auswählen
Serial.println(pcf.digitalRead(P2),DEC);
-
- Beiträge: 52
- Registriert: 08.03.2019, 12:17
- Hat sich bedankt: 7 Mal
- Danksagung erhalten: 2 Mal
Re: Windrichtung 8 Sektoren pot.-frei
Das "val == LOW" habe ich geändert. Es stand auf HIGH.
Dann ist es genau andersherum. Das wollte ich auch testen.
Das mit dem „read“ werde ich mal testen.
Dann ist es genau andersherum. Das wollte ich auch testen.
Das mit dem „read“ werde ich mal testen.